ADVISOR WEBCAST讲座问答:新一代高性能多语言支持的虚拟机GraalVM介绍及其在WebLogic上的使用 (Mandarin Only), 2023年11月22日
Advisor Webcast 主题: 新一代高性能多语言支持的虚拟机GraalVM介绍及其在WebLogic上的使用
简介:
本次讲座我们将分享在使用Oracle中间件产品遇到问题的时候,如何更简单快速地得到技术支持、有哪些中间件产品能够获得中文服务、加快SR解决速度的技巧等问题,以及以下关于GraalVM的技术讲座内容:
GraalVM 是一个具有多语言支持和高性能编译器的通用虚拟机,旨在提供更好的性能和灵活性,使开发人员能够在不同的编程语言之间进行无缝切换和集成。
传统的虚拟机(比如Java虚拟机)通常专注于一种特定的编程语言,而 GraalVM 则支持多种语言,包括但不限于Java、JavaScript、Python、Ruby、R 和C++等。GraalVM 提供一个高性能、低开销的运行环境,使得不同的编程语言可以在同一个虚拟机上运行。GraalVM 的核心技术是 Graal 编译器,它是一种基于即时编译(Just-In-Time, JIT)技术的高性能编译器。Graal 编译器采用了一种称为部分评估(Partial Evaluation)的技术,通过静态分析和优化来提高程序的性能。这使得 GraalVM 在执行各种编程语言的代码时能够获得较好的性能表现。
此外,GraalVM 还提供了一些其他的功能,如与本机代码的互操作性、嵌入式执行支持、即时故障处理等。它可以在各种操作系统和硬件架构上运行,并且可以作为独立的工具使用,也可以与其他开发工具(如IDE和构建系统)集成。
本讲座将综合介绍GraalVM的License、特点、优势,还会重点讲述GraalVM在WebLogic上的安装、配置、使用。通过此次讲解,相信您会对GraalVM有更加全面和深入的了解!
通过此次讲解,您将了解以下内容
- GraalVM虚拟机简介
- GraalVM虚拟机Licence介绍
- GraalVM虚拟机为什么会更快
- GraalVM虚拟机内存管理特点
- GraalVM虚拟机多语言混合编程
- 使用GraalVM编译java程序为本机独立执行代码
- GraalVM虚拟机与WebLogic的认证情况
- GraalVM虚拟机下载、安装、运行WebLogic配置
本次讲座的PPT和录音请参考以下链接:
Advisor Webcast 讲座录音: 新一代高性能多语言支持的虚拟机GraalVM介绍及其在WebLogic上的使用 (Mandarin Only), 2023年11月22日 [video] (Doc ID 2976369.1)
查询未来将会举行哪些讲座,以及过去的讲座的语音录音文件,请参考文档Doc ID 1456204.1 Oracle Fusion Middleware Advisor Webcast Schedule and Archived Recordings